Located in Geyserville, CA  •  Web ID: XBHQ

Discover a secret hidden in the hills above Alexander Valley and unlock the key to becoming immersed in a tranquil wine country lifestyle.  Take a moment to escape the hectic life that exists beyond these hills and form an everlasting connection to the land as the steward of this tremendous estate.

This incredible property embodies an unparalleled Vintner experience in a pristine, 200 +/- acre setting overlooking the world renowned Alexander Valley . Olive groves grace the primary slope as you make your way up the hillside to see the strikingly beautiful residence overlooking the expansive view of the valley below. To the northeast, the exquisite 26 +/- acres of terraced vineyards that form an amphitheater carved into the mountains provide yet another luxurious view. A shimmering pond invites you to drop a fishing line in the water or just enjoy the reflections of the surrounding hillside vineyard.  Complemented by extensive culinary gardens and fruit orchards this is all woven together to create an idyllic life in harmony with nature.

The fruit from the dynamic estate vineyard has been used to create the highly acclaimed wines for Skipstone. With the unique shape of the vineyard and incredible array of soils and exposures, the vineyard provides the foundation in which to grow exceptional fruit. Years of careful stewardship of the vineyard and the surrounding property has earned the CCOF designation for Organic farming.  Characterized by the ‘sweet tannins’, the wine made from the Cabernet Sauvignon grown at the estate has been compared to some of the best wines Napa Valley has to offer. The resulting accolades from wine critics and customers alike have vaulted this wine to star status.

"... polished and silky is the dense purple-colored 2007 Cabernet Sauvignon Oliver's Blend. Composed of 96% Cabernet Sauvignon and 4% Cabernet Franc, it exhibits an attractive chocolaty, herbal, espresso roast, and black currant-scented nose, medium to full body, an endearing texture, and a heady finish."  Robert Park, Jr. The Wine Advocate - 92 points

The main residence, clad in circa 200 year old Pennsylvania barn wood, embodies a chic rustic style that invites instant relaxation and escape. As you enter the home, you are struck by the space and openness of the design and glorious views from every area of the house.  Despite its generous 8,200 +/- square foot size, the warmth of the materials and authenticity of the architecture create a welcoming environment.  Sky high ceilings lay the framework for the living room, and open portals to the conservatory and the dining room provide a natural flow from room to room making the entertaining areas warm and inviting.  Finished in 1994, this 6 bedroom home’s casual aesthetic incorporates reclaimed Chestnut flooring, soaring old-world fireplaces and hand-hewn oak beams that form the dramatic architecture. 

The showcase Chef’s kitchen and large center island provide an ideal stage for culinary creations and casual entertaining.  The kitchen is complemented by a circular dining area for less formal occasions.  Just off the kitchen, a spacious dining room with fireplace is open to multiple configurations for your special events and holiday celebrations.

Adjacent to the kitchen bar, a comfortable family room provides a more intimate space to unwind after a busy day and is adjacent to three bedrooms, two of which are en-suite. The artisan spiral staircase leads to two additional guest suites and yet another spacious living area with a warm fireplace and bar overlooking the formal living room downstairs.

The master suite wing features a fireplace, two dressing rooms, large master bathroom, formal office or sitting room and a private patio overlooking the stunning Alexander Valley .

Multiple patios and sitting areas surrounding rolling lawns and majestic oaks provide the perfect setting for soaking in the breathtaking views.  Tucked away in the vineyards shaded by large oaks, a lovely picnic area invites you to enjoy the wines or just take in the picturesque vistas.  If you are lucky you might see an eagle riding the thermals high above.

The lovely grounds include a rose cutting garden, extensive plantings and 1.5 +/- acres of organic culinary gardens and orchards. The produce from this garden is donated to the Ceres Community Project. A substantial greenhouse and chicken coup are nestled in the gardens and add to the charm of this sustainable property.  For hikers there are forested hills or gentle walks through the vineyard and olive grove.  The 7-stall barn and riding arena perched on the ridge overlooking the valley welcomes horse enthusiasts.

The residential compound includes a four car garage, swimming pool, pool house, and office.  The office overlooks the vineyards and can easily be converted to a guest cottage or caretaker’s home.

Embraced by the nature of the Alexander Valley , within minutes of the charming town of Healdsburg, this unique estate is a dazzling archetype of what typifies life in Northern California ’s wine Country. As the day winds to an end, the sun sets, and the moon gently graces the evening sky, you can find yourself sharing the bounties of the land with a glass of wine, enjoying an environment of unparalleled beauty and contentment. 

 (Please note that the brand Skipstone and related inventory or marketing rights are not included in the offering).
